Oh, the glamorous life of the freelance SEO writer.
Who wouldn't want to be able to get paid to write articles? But while the allure of working from any location may be out there, many freelancers end up hurting themselves when they start their new business.
If you're an aspiring entrepreneur that wants to get started with SEO writing, here are 3 rules that you should swear by: Rule #1: Don't procrastinate You may have the blazing fingers of a court stenographer, but that doesn't mean you should hold off on completing those 30 articles that you were hired for.
Don't wait until the day before your deadline to finish them when you had a whole week to do so.
It will only make your work day more stressful and more miserable.
In turn, finish those articles sooner.
You won't have to scramble to churn out your work just for the sake of finishing.
In turn, your quality will be better and your work day will be less stressful.
Rule #2: Market, Market, Market With work trickling in or starting to pick up, you may end up getting lazy on advertising yourself for more work.
But you can't always be guaranteed clients that will want to pay you to write articles.
When it comes down to it, articles mean money.
And once that stops, so does your electricity (along with food, water, and probably rent, too).
Don't forget to keep marketing yourself.
Strive to have clients that are willing to pay you for your services so you won't have to worry about having enough money for your bills.
With that being said...
Rule #3: It's Not Just About the Money While pumping out article after article after article will earn you more money, remember why you decided to enter the world of freelance SEO writing.
For some, it was the freedom of being your own boss.
Or maybe it was the freedom of controlling when and where you work.
For others, it was having the ability to work from home and spend more time with your friends and family.
Whatever it may be, stay motivated and have your goals set out in front of you 100% of the time.
You want to avoid being burnt out and unmotivated to do even the simplest of articles.
There you have it.
If you adhere to these 3 simple rules, your new life as a freelance SEO writer will stay enjoyable as you explore your new freedom.
